Oil For Caliper Slide Pins . Regularly check the brake caliper slide pins for any signs of wear or damage. Always use synthetic grease made specifically for brake caliper sliding pins and rubber boots such as sylglide, crc brake. You want to use a silicone or polyalkylene glycol lubricant (synthetic greases) and apply it evenly to your pins. 1) it lubricates— when applied to the caliper slide pins, brake grease allows the pins to slide smoothly even at high temperatures.
